In the 1980s and 1990s, luxury brand names began to expand their customer base by providing even more cost effective products. These brands given items that were still considered glamorous, yet at a much more affordable rate.
Plus, accessories, unlike specialty knitwear or cashmere coats, can be utilized daily, validating the acquisition. These skilled 3rd parties can produce these accessories at a lower cost than internal manufacturing.
This business model makes devices exceptionally profitable for luxury brand names. Deluxe brands make a substantial profit from devices. Some people think that several large high-end style residences are essentially accessories brands that use runway fashion mostly for marketing, records Glossy. copyright is an archetype of this, as from 2012 to 2017, almost 60% of its complete income originated from natural leather items and footwear, which is far even more than any kind of various other market.

In addition, high-end brand names deal with a higher challenge as younger generations become much more conscious concerning the environment, society, and economic climate. They are more inclined to purchase from business that adopt lasting techniques and address concerns they appreciate. To catch the environmentally-conscious Millennials and Gen Z, deluxe brands are welcoming sustainability, as these generations are expected to comprise 70% of the deluxe market by 2025. It is vital for brand names to reassess their business methods and prioritize sustainability to appeal to this new generation of customers.
In current years, there has been a rise in deluxe brand names embracing sustainable practices. This consists of making use of green article source products, revamping packaging, donating or offering leftover fabrics to avoid waste, and devoting to minimizing their carbon impact.
Prioritizing openness is essential to prevent adverse promotion. Brands considered as socially responsible and transparent concerning their methods are most likely to be relied on and have a favorable brand name online reputation. Nevertheless, the global fashion business is still hesitant to divulge specific information about its supply chains. Some deluxe brand names, such as Louis Vuitton and Cartier, are leading the method by partnering with Aura Blockchain Consortium, the world's first global deluxe blockchain.

In the post-pandemic era, brick-and-mortar shops have actually made use of 'hyperphysical' retail to bring in buyers click this back to physical stores. After a lengthy duration of separation and an enhanced reliance on shopping, consumers are currently looking for new and exciting retail experiences.
According to a report by The Service of Style, 31% of luxury customers see physical shops a minimum of once a month, favoring the benefits of in person communications. Additionally, 68% of deluxe buyers think that involving a physical shop is essential for customer care. Separate study commissioned by the global innovation company Epson exposes that 75% of European shoppers would change their buying behavior if high road stores supplied much more experiential alternatives.
